Description
'Eh-1571 Herbicide' is an herbicide. Its Federal EPA registration number is: 2217-1012. It was originally approved by EPA on 05 Nov 2015. It has a 'Caution' signal word. It has the following active ingredients: Dichlobenil and Glyphosate-isopropylammonium. It's approved for 8 sites including buildings and structures, domestic dwellings, driveways, fence rows, paths, patios, paved areas, and walks. It is also approved for 173 pests and pest groups including but not limited to alder, american beech, annual bluegrass, annual spurge, arrowwood, ash, aspen, autumn olive, bahiagrass, and baldcypress.

Active ingredients:
- Dichlobenil 0.84%
- Glyphosate-isopropylammonium 0.74%
- Other ingredients 98.42%
